Job Description :

As the Intel Support Lead of a national defense program space warfighting mission, you will be responsible for a team providing mission protection operators and decision-makers with intel analysis, reports and briefings to warn of counterspace (kinetic and non-kinetic) threats and assessed vulnerabilities to space & ground assets. The Intel Support Lead is a subject matter expert (SME) on terrestrial and on-orbit counterspace threats and will guide research and assessments amongst team members working in an operations-focused Intelligence Division. Your team will work closely with flight safety and mission protection staff and support Indication & Warning (I&W) system integration efforts that progress database accuracy and efficiencies in mission execution. Additionally, the successful candidate will continuously endeavor to close organizational knowledge gaps in an ever-changing space domain environment via committed collaboration, expert collection analysis and balanced resource tasking.
